Oreodytes sanmarkii
Species of beetle From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Oreodytes sanmarkii is a species of predaceous diving beetle in the family Dytiscidae.[1][2][3] It has a holarctic distribution, found in aquatic habitats in Europe, northern Asia (excluding China), and North America.[2] It has an affinity toward low-velocity currents and pebbly microhabitat substrates.[4][5] It was described by Finnish entomologist Carl Reinhold Sahlberg in 1826.

Subspecies
There are two named subspecies of Oreodytes:[2]
- Oreodytes sanmarkii alienus (Sharp, 1873)
- Oreodytes sanmarkii sanmarkii (C. R. Sahlberg, 1826)
